    It wasn't the best although wss looked like he was having a good time.

    Cancelled train to london got the day off to a bad start. Missed half of ocs whilst getting in and queuing at the tokens booth then the beer tent. Queues massive everywhere.

    Saw proclaimers, athelete, joe lean and the jing jang jong then spent 1/2 walking across field to tiny gap to get thru to arena stage where I heard the last song by ladyhawke from afar. Then got in queue for toilets which was a joke and humungous so missed half of the streets. Dec queued at bar only to turn back as there was a crush and he was missing streets. Then we got food - fat of pork in a bap which took 15 mins to queue for. Then attempted the bar again. Dec got 3 drinks but the crush made him drop one. Not impressed. Listened to human league as the crossing to other stages for elbow were chocca blocked. Saw lady gaga, I say saw, couldn't get anywhere near. Decs sister missed most of it due to bar queues where security stood on bar to push people back. We then decided to leave as the options were keane or snow patrol and we didn't fancy getting in a crush getting out if we stayed for mgmt.sadly as our exit was in a certain direction, we had to endure 2 snowpatrol songs and keane 'rocking out' argh! Got on bus and train straight away then got off at stratford - jubilee line shut. Sat on dlr for 55 mins and when at lewisham had missed train by 5 mins. Got bus from lewisham and only thing open was morelys who sold us mangy 4 day old chicked covered with mayo.

    Won't be going again. My friends camping had a great time, which I'm glad for but it was badly laid out, badly organised - not helped by oasis pulling out which must have messed up their crowd expectations for all stages.
